Reimbursement Analyst – Per Diem
Overview:
The Title IV-E Analyst works as part of a review and compliance team responsible for evaluating provider contract documentation to ensure provider costs and state/federal reimbursements comply with federal and state regulations. Acting as the first line of communication between providers and the Pennsylvania Department of Human Services (DHS) Office of Children Youth and Families (OCYF), the Title IV-E Analyst is essential in developing federal and state reimbursements. This role involves calculating provider per diems and reimbursement rates, assisting with training and bulletin preparation, tracking progress, and maintaining compliance with documentation standards. The analyst also provides education, information, and technical assistance to county office personnel, providers, and state employees.

Specific Responsibilities:
- Master and apply Pennsylvania's policies and procedures for Title IV-E allowable claiming for foster care providers covering direct and indirect costs.
- Interpret and apply federal regulations to various service provider situations.
- Independently analyze documentation and provide technical assistance using critical thinking skills.
- Implement both federal and state regulations for financial reporting.
- Understand the relationship between service activities and financial accountability.
- Review and analyze financial reports and datasets for compliance with federal and state standards.
- Travel within Pennsylvania as necessary.
- Maintain consistent communication with providers, counties, and OCYF staff.
- Provide technical assistance and support as needed.
- Identify trends in compliance issues and recommend best practices for business processes.
